Saun Rituals

In the heart of Estonia, saunas are more than just a place to relax; they are an integral part of lifestyle. Time-honored practices embrace every aspect of a sauna experience, from the ritualistic cleansing before entering the steamy air to the rejuvenating plunge in a cold water lake.

A typical Estonian sauna ritual starts with a gentle scrubbing using birch branches or a rough cloth, followed by a slow and rhythmic build-up of heat. As the intensity rises, bathers sit on wooden benches, enjoying the cleansing effects of the steam while communicating stories and laughter with friends and family.

Upon completion with the sauna session, a refreshing dip in a cold water body is essential to conclude the ritual. The sharp contrast of temperatures awakens the senses and leaves one feeling renewed.
